From: Mike Taylor Date: Fri, 15 Oct 2010 12:07:58 +0000 (+0100) Subject: More explicit report when title-term-in-list test fails. X-Git-Tag: v1.28~6 X-Git-Url: http://jsfdemo.indexdata.com/?a=commitdiff_plain;h=f2e9c8fbb53bd25479c6666069b27df2940d31ba;p=ZOOM-Perl-moved-to-github.git More explicit report when title-term-in-list test fails. displayTerm==term assertion is now case-insensitive. --- diff --git a/t/15-scan.t b/t/15-scan.t index e2904a3..d17746c 100644 --- a/t/15-scan.t +++ b/t/15-scan.t @@ -31,7 +31,8 @@ foreach my $i (1 .. $n) { my $disp = Net::Z3950::ZOOM::scanset_display_term($ss, $i-1, $occ, $len); ok(defined $disp && $len eq length($disp), "display term $i of $n: '$disp' ($occ occurences)"); - ok($disp eq $term, "display term $i ($disp) identical to term ($term)"); + ok(lc($disp) eq lc($term), + "display term $i ($disp) equivalent to term ($term)"); } Net::Z3950::ZOOM::scanset_destroy($ss); @@ -51,7 +52,8 @@ foreach my $i (1 .. $n) { "got title term $i of $n: '$term' ($occ occurences)"); ok($term ge $previous, "title term '$term' ge previous '$previous'"); $previous = $term; - ok((grep { $term eq $_ } @terms), "title term was in term list"); + ok((grep { $term eq $_ } @terms), + "title term ($term) was in term list (@terms)"); } Net::Z3950::ZOOM::scanset_destroy($ss);